Wood Island Park is added to the Boston Park system.

1891

Designed by Charles Olmsted, it subsequently includes a beach, tennis courts, a track, picnic areas, and a municipal building and bathhouse designed by Sturgis & Cabot, and is completed in 1895. It is subsequently renamed World War Memorial Park. A portion of the park is taken for construction of an airport in 1922, and the remainder for expansion of the airport in 1969 [1968].
